Interior Design

When I began my college career, I wanted one an Interior Designer. I spent my first three years at LSU in the Interior Design program before switching to Marketing. Even though I decided to not pursue Interior Design, I am grateful for the knowledge I gained from the LSU School of Design. I learned valuable computer skills with Photoshop and AutoCad. Moreover, I studied the elements of design and was able to use my creativity in ways I never thought I could. The skills that I learned in Interior Design makes me better at marketing, I have an eye for design and for what looks good, and I enjoy transferring that knowledge into marketing practices.
